History.
K. Grenfell left Kingston University in 1991 and has since worked as a professional artist with commissions for a variety of clients around the globe. In 2002 Karen set up her own creative enterprise, Mimi and Mimilove.co.uk , providing a range of artworks from pop art style contemporary portraiture, traditional watercolours and collage for both individual and commercial clientelle.
In 2004 & 2005 works appeared at the Birmingham Nec as part of Memorabilia UK show, it was these appearances that led to several works being signed by celebrities; from sporting heroes including World Cup winner Sir Geoff Hurst MBE and boxing legend Sir Henry Cooper OBE. It was this that eventually lead to the auctioning of the Sir Henry Cooper portrait at Sotheby's sporting memorabilia sale later that year. Mimilove went onto have works signed by Hollywood superstar David Carridine, "Bill" in Quentin Tarrantino's Kill Bill movies and former Bond girl Britt Ekland.
MimiLove has also been involved with provding bespoke illustrations and artworks for one of the UK's premier recording facilities Blast Recording, VIFI Award winning indi film maker's Brand New Films and children's author Beki Hough. A collaboration with entrepreneur Steve Wraith and Punk legend and former Sex Pistol Glen Matlock helped to raise funds for children's charity The Bubble Foundation UK and is currently involved in a project with former Scorpions keyboard player and prog rock musician John Young
